Laundry room plumbing tips

You do not have to be a washing machine installationplumbing professional to know a little about your washing machine. This useful device makes our lives a lot easier, it's essential that we treat it well so it remains in excellent condition for several years to come. An easy method to keep your machine running smoothly is to inspect its hose pipes. If you discover indications of wear, think about replacing old rubber hose pipes with ones made from braided stainless steel. These newer materials will last longer and are much less most likely to break or leak. In order to find something wrong, watch on your washing machine water line. If you see this line significantly changing you might have an obstruction or other issue within your washer. A typical issue that occurs with a washer is that the drain line will obstruct with hair and other particles from the laundry. Ensure you have a strainer on your washing machine hose to keep out these potentially bothersome products. Another blockage that may occur is within the pipes. Water heater maintenance

Your water heater is the other major home appliance in the basement. This useful gadget controls the temperature of the water in all of your sinks, bath tubs and showers. In order to keep your bathing and dishwashing habits comfortable and not too hot, you'll need to sometimes do some maintenance on your water heater. To keep yours running and in good condition, you'll need to flush the tank and inspect the anode rod each year..

To flush your tank, first switch off the electricity and water to the heater. Then wait several hours for it to cool. When you can touch the tank and is no longer warm, utilize a garden pipe and pump to drain it. The water coming from the tank needs to be put into a bucket so you can see what color it is. Dark water indicates there is a lot of mineral accumulation. This can rust your tank and cause problems with the temperature level. Fill up the tank with tidy water and after that repeat this draining procedure till the water is clear. Eliminate your pipe and pump and turn on both the water and electrical energy so your hot water heater can go back to its typical performance.
